Trewoon is a small village nestled on the favoured, western outskirts of St Austell and has a range of amenities including Post Office and convenience store, a hairdressing salon, and a church. The regenerated town of St Austell is within walking distance of the property and offers a wide range of shopping, educational and recreational facilities. There is a mainline railway station and leisure centre together with primary and secondary schools and supermarkets. The historic and picturesque port of Charlestown plus the award winning Eden Project are both within a short drive. The town of Fowey is approximately eight miles away and is well known for its restaurants and coastal walks while the city of Truro is approximately thirteen miles from the property.
